Road Song by Natalie Kusz
A Memoir
"Road Song" is a poignant memoir that recounts the author's harrowing childhood after her family moves to Alaska in pursuit of a simpler life. The narrative delves into the struggles they face, including a tragic accident that leaves the author disfigured and the family's ongoing battle with poverty, isolation, and the harsh Alaskan wilderness. Through vivid storytelling, the memoir explores themes of resilience, family bonds, and the pursuit of the American dream, all while painting a stark portrait of the challenges and beauty found in the untamed northern frontier.
